We are part of a long-established sports network, School Sports Games and Atlas Games, which organises many sporting festivals. They allow us to compete against local schools in a variety of sports. In addition, intra-school competitions prepare children to take part and fulfil their potential. Our programme of study includes a progression of skills, and each child has the opportunity for two hours of PE a week. In addition, we use dance, gymnastics, invasion games, net/wall games, striking and fielding games, athletics, and outdoor adventurous activities to deliver quality first teaching and promote a lifelong active lifestyle. We have specialist teachers and instructors that support physical education within our curriculum. In addition, all teachers receive training and opportunity to keep developing their subject knowledge, skills, and understanding to support curriculum development throughout the school. We have an extensive physical after-school provision that aims to create confident and healthy children. The Weekly MileThe Weekly Mile is a fully-inclusive, free and simple initiative which improves the physical and mental health and wellbeing of children. We do it every Friday morning before school starts.
